Output 76664e53e72a8f05d9a2aa4e9fad7f2c19cc58caa48fbe5e62c75442542b98bd: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198e76bface3eb91002898f757d6fffb3e751d1d OP_EQUAL
address
9tmQDkM8wuuag4FcTfepqSU1YzSWAmua2u
transaction
76664e53e72a8f05d9a2aa4e9fad7f2c19cc58caa48fbe5e62c75442542b98bd